Diferența dintre DBMS și sistemul de gestionare a fișierelor

Cuprins:

Diferența dintre DBMS și sistemul de gestionare a fișierelor
Diferența dintre DBMS și sistemul de gestionare a fișierelor

Video: Diferența dintre DBMS și sistemul de gestionare a fișierelor

Video: Diferența dintre DBMS și sistemul de gestionare a fișierelor
Video: File System vs. Database Management System 2024, Iulie
Anonim

Diferența cheie dintre DBMS și sistemul de gestionare a fișierelor este că un SGBD stochează date pe hard disk conform unei structuri, în timp ce un sistem de gestionare a fișierelor stochează date pe hard disk fără a utiliza o structură.

DBMS este un software de sistem pentru crearea și gestionarea bazelor de date într-un mod organizat, în timp ce un sistem de gestionare a fișierelor este un software care gestionează fișierele de date într-un sistem informatic.

Diferența dintre DBMS și sistemul de gestionare a fișierelor_Rezumat de comparație
Diferența dintre DBMS și sistemul de gestionare a fișierelor_Rezumat de comparație

Ce este DBMS?

DBMS înseamnă Database Management System și ajută la crearea și gestionarea bazelor de date, care sunt colecții de date. În plus, DBMS stochează datele în tabele. Aici, mai întâi, utilizatorul ar trebui să creeze structura pentru a stoca datele. Apoi stocarea datelor are loc conform acelei structuri.

Diferența dintre DBMS și sistemul de gestionare a fișierelor
Diferența dintre DBMS și sistemul de gestionare a fișierelor

Un avantaj major al DBMS din cauza acestei structuri este că oferă interogare. Este ușor să accesați, să căutați, să actualizați și să ștergeți datele folosind interogări. Structured Query Language (SQL) este limbajul de scriere a interogărilor pentru DBMS. SGBD-ul menține un singur depozit de date și mulți utilizatori accesează acest singur depozit. De asemenea, menține integritatea datelor prin utilizarea constrângerilor. În plus, reduce redundanța datelor și crește consistența datelor.

SGBD-ul acceptă mediul multi-utilizator. Prin urmare, mulți utilizatori pot accesa datele în același timp. De asemenea, este posibil să faceți o dată la dispoziția unui departament, care nu este disponibilă pentru altul. În general, un SGBD este potrivit pentru o organizație mare pentru a gestiona multe înregistrări.

Ce este sistemul de gestionare a fișierelor?

Un sistem de gestionare a fișierelor se ocupă de modul de citire și scriere a datelor pe hard disk. La instalarea sistemului de operare, sistemul de fișiere se instalează și pe computer. De exemplu, sistemele de operare precum Linux și Windows oferă sisteme de fișiere. Stochează date pe hard disk, iar stocarea și preluarea datelor au loc prin intermediul acestui sistem de gestionare a fișierelor.

Într-un sistem de fișiere, fiecare utilizator implementează fișiere conform cerințelor. De exemplu, într-un departament de vânzări, un angajat poate stoca detaliile personalului de vânzări, iar un alt angajat poate stoca detaliile salariilor. Aceleași date pot fi replicate. Deci, poate exista o redundanță de date. La actualizarea datelor, utilizatorul trebuie să verifice toate locurile în care există date. Uitarea de a modifica actualizările poate cauza inconsecvența datelor. Uneori, este necesar să stocați datele în funcție de condiții. Aplicarea constrângerilor este, de asemenea, dificilă cu un sistem de gestionare a fișierelor. Un sistem de gestionare a fișierelor este mai potrivit pentru o organizație mică pentru a face față unui număr mic de clienți.

Care este diferența dintre DBMS și sistemul de gestionare a fișierelor?

DBMS vs. Sistem de gestionare a fișierelor

DBMS este un software de sistem pentru crearea și gestionarea bazelor de date care oferă o modalitate sistematică de a crea, prelua, actualiza și gestiona date. Un sistem de gestionare a fișierelor este un software care gestionează fișierele de date într-un sistem informatic.
Redundanța datelor
Redundanța datelor este scăzută într-un SGBD. Într-un sistem de gestionare a fișierelor, redundanța datelor este mare.
Consecvență
În DBMS, consistența datelor este ridicată. Coerența datelor este scăzută în sistemul de gestionare a fișierelor.
Partajarea datelor
Partajarea datelor este mai ușoară în DBMS. Partajarea datelor este mai dificilă în sistemul de gestionare a fișierelor.

Integritate

Integritatea datelor este ridicată în DBMS. În sistemul de gestionare a fișierelor, integritatea datelor este scăzută.
Operațiuni
Actualizarea, căutarea, preluarea datelor este mai ușoară în SGBD din cauza interogărilor. Actualizarea, căutarea, preluarea datelor este mai dificilă într-un sistem de gestionare a fișierelor.
Securitate
În DBMS, datele sunt mai sigure. Datele nu sunt foarte sigure în sistemul de gestionare a fișierelor.
Proces de backup și de recuperare
Procesul de backup și de recuperare este complex într-un SGBD. Procesul de backup și de recuperare este simplu într-un sistem de fișiere.
Număr de utilizatori
DBMS este potrivit pentru organizațiile mari pentru a sprijini mai mulți utilizatori. Sistemul de gestionare a fișierelor este potrivit pentru organizații mici sau utilizatori unici.

Rezumat – DBMS vs Sistem de gestionare a fișierelor

Diferența dintre DBMS și sistemul de gestionare a fișierelor este că un DBMS stochează date pe hard disk conform unei structuri, în timp ce un sistem de gestionare a fișierelor stochează date pe hard disk fără a utiliza o structură. DBMS oferă partajarea datelor și este mai flexibil decât un sistem de gestionare a fișierelor.

Recomandat: